Our sustainability commitment
We are a privately owned company with long-term shareholder commitment to reinvest in:
- Energy Efficiency Improvements
- Sustainable Material Sourcing
- Circular Economy Practices
- Employee Development & Inclusion
- Biodiversity
Our efforts are guided by a dedicated full-time Sustainability Lead, with active support from our Managing Director, Production Manager, and external sustainability consultants.
We hold an IMS integrating ISO 9001 and ISO 14001 certifications and align many of our practices with the Corporate Sustainability Reporting Directive (CSRD).

Biodiversity
We host and maintain active bee hives both on company grounds and at offsite locations, supporting local pollinators and ecosystem diversity as part of our broader ecological mission.
